Understanding the Greek Ferry System

Before diving into the timing of booking Greek ferries, it’s essential to understand the ferry system in Greece. The Greek ferry network is extensive, connecting the mainland to the islands and providing an efficient mode of transportation for both locals and tourists. With numerous ferry companies operating in Greece, there is a wide range of ferry routes available, catering to different islands and destinations.

Factors to Consider

When determining the ideal timing for booking Greek ferries, several factors come into play. These include the time of year, popular routes, demand, and the flexibility of travel plans. Here are the key factors that influence the timing of booking Greek ferries:

Peak Season vs. Off-peak Season

Greece experiences peak tourist seasons during the summer months when travelers from all over the world flock to the islands to bask in the Mediterranean sun. During these peak months, the demand for ferry tickets is significantly high, and popular routes may get fully booked well in advance. In contrast, the off-peak season sees fewer tourists, resulting in lower demand for ferry tickets and increased availability.

Popular Routes and Islands

Certain ferry routes and islands are more popular than others, attracting a higher volume of travelers. Islands like Santorini, Mykonos, and Crete are hot favorites among tourists, and ferry tickets for these destinations tend to sell out quickly, especially during peak season. On the other hand, lesser-known islands may have more availability even with short notice.

Booking in Advance

Based on my personal experiences and thorough research, I have found that booking Greek ferries in advance is highly recommended, especially if you are traveling during the peak season or have a strict itinerary. Securing your ferry tickets in advance not only ensures availability but also provides peace of mind, allowing you to plan your travel logistics with confidence.

Advance Booking Timeline

So, how far in advance should you book Greek ferries? The recommended timeline for booking Greek ferries can vary depending on the time of year and the specific routes you intend to travel. Here is a general guideline to help you plan your ferry bookings:

Peak Season (May to September)

During the peak summer months, it is advisable to book your Greek ferry tickets at least 2 to 3 months in advance, especially if you are traveling to popular islands such as Santorini, Mykonos, or Rhodes. These routes experience high demand, and ferry companies often release their schedules and tickets well ahead of time.

Off-peak Season (October to April)

For travel during the off-peak season, such as autumn or spring, booking your Greek ferry tickets 1 to 2 months in advance should be sufficient. With lower tourist numbers, you are likely to find more availability and flexibility in your travel plans, allowing for last-minute bookings if needed.

Last-Minute Bookings

For travelers who prefer a more spontaneous approach, last-minute ferry bookings are also possible, especially during the off-peak season or for less popular routes. However, it’s important to note that last-minute availability may be limited, and there is a risk of not securing desired departure times or cabin classes.

FAQs

1. Can I change my ferry booking after I’ve made a reservation?

Most ferry companies in Greece allow changes to bookings, including date and time amendments, subject to availability and applicable fees. It’s advisable to check the specific terms and conditions of your chosen ferry company regarding booking modifications.

2. Is it cheaper to book Greek ferries in advance?

Booking Greek ferries in advance can often result in securing lower fares, especially during promotional periods or early bird offers. Additionally, advance bookings provide the advantage of choosing from a wider range of available ticket options.

3. What happens if my ferry gets canceled due to weather conditions?

In the event of ferry cancellations due to adverse weather, ferry companies typically offer alternative arrangements, such as rescheduled departures or ticket refunds. It’s essential to stay updated on weather-related travel advisories and communicate with the ferry company for assistance.

4. Are there any alternatives to ferries for traveling between Greek islands?

Apart from ferries, alternative transportation options for inter-island travel in Greece include domestic flights, hydrofoils, and catamarans. Each mode of transport offers unique benefits and travel experiences, catering to different preferences and time constraints.

5. Can I purchase Greek ferry tickets online?

Yes, most Greek ferry companies have online booking platforms that allow travelers to purchase tickets in advance, select seat preferences, and receive e-tickets for a seamless travel experience. Online booking also provides the convenience of reviewing schedules and making informed travel plans.
